The most intelligent and informed participants on Jeopardy! respond to hints that most home viewers find confusing. Jeopardy! is the most watched quiz program on television.

To the amazement of many Christian viewers, all three finalists in a recent program were stumped by one ostensibly straightforward hint referencing the Lord’s Prayer.

During the June 13 episode, host Mayim Bialik read the clue for $200, the lowest and frequently simplest number on the board, under the heading “Dadjectives.”

It states in Matthew 6:9, “This “Be Thy Name,” ‘Our Father Who Art In Heaven.'”

The response, “hallowed” (or rather, “what is hallowed,” per Jeopardy! rules), will be well-known to anybody who recalls studying the Lord’s Prayer in Sunday school.

Even seemingly basic answers on Jeopardy! regularly stump the contestants, but the fact that no one could figure out the answer to one of Christianity’s most well-known prayers seems to have struck a nerve among the faithful.

The fact that every contestant couldn’t answer a seemingly easy question surprised some viewers, but others remained more composed. Two of the contestants may have opted to play it safe rather than take a chance of falling farther behind due to their poor scores.

It’s also crucial to remember that Jeopardy! regularly asks questions on Christianity and the Bible, and contestants frequently correctly answer issues that even devout Christians would find challenging. In fact, it’s such a common topic that some have criticized the show for include too many questions on Christianity.

These three candidates most likely did not grow up in the same Christian context as many viewers since Jeopardy! admits players from various backgrounds and religious views.

The Final Jeopardy response was “He starred in the 2 films whose soundtracks were the top 2 bestselling albums of 1978.” The participants struggled with the Lord’s Prayer, but they performed a little bit better with ’70s films.

The proper response? John Travolta (the soundtracks for Saturday Night Fever and Grease). Competitor Suresh Krishnan triumphed, extending his winning streak to six games.
